Growing Spider Plant (Saga) in Kajiado
Soil suitability analysis based on Kajiado's nutrient profile
Kajiado County is a solid choice for Spider Plant (Saga), with a soil-match score of 62/100. Local soils average pH 6.55 — neutral and inside the 5.8–7 band Spider Plant (Saga) prefers, so no lime is usually required. The main gap is nitrogen — measured at N 0.97 g/kg, P 20.6 mg/kg, K 257 mg/kg against this crop's high/medium/medium demand — so the fertilizer plan below prioritises closing that deficit. The county's predominantly sandy loam soils suit Spider Plant (Saga), which favours loam. Spider Plant (Saga)'s full potential is about 5,000 kg/acre (~KES 250,000/acre at KES 50/kg), but at Kajiado's 62/100 suitability a realistic target here is closer to 3,875 kg/acre (~KES 193,750/acre) unless the constraints above are addressed.
Soil & climate match
| Factor | Kajiado soil | Spider Plant (Saga) needs |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| pH | 6.55 | 5.8–7 | OK |
| Nitrogen | 0.97 g/kg | min 1.2 g/kg | Low |
| Phosphorus | 20.6 mg/kg | min 12 mg/kg | OK |
| Potassium | 257 mg/kg | min 150 mg/kg | OK |
| Rainfall | 500 mm | 600–1,400 mm | Low |
| Altitude | 1,300 m | 0–2,200 m | OK |
